gnat-llvm
Ada compiler
An Ada compiler based on LLVM to generate native code from the GNAT front-end.
LLVM based GNAT compiler
185 stars
26 watching
18 forks
Language: Ada
last commit: 2 months ago Related projects:
Repository | Description | Stars |
---|---|---|
| A collection of core packages for building Ada libraries and applications | 45 |
| Analyzes program coverage in Ada and C language source code | 39 |
| Provides bindings to commonly used C libraries for use in Ada programs | 14 |
| A collection of pre-packaged C components for building databases. | 11 |
| A toolset that compiles Ada and SPARK code to NVIDIA GPUs | 18 |
| An LSP client prototype for Visual Studio 2017 implementing support for the Ada programming language | 1 |
| A Haskell-based LLVM backend for generating LLVM bytecode from Idris programs | 78 |
| A JSON serialization/deserialization library for Ada Standard containers and types | 7 |
| A compiler that generates native executables from the Ballerina programming language using LLVM. | 137 |
| A resurrected and improved implementation of the LLVM C Backend in Groff, enabling compilation of programs written in various programming languages to native machine code. | 127 |
| An implementation of the Microsoft Language Server Protocol for Ada/SPARK and GPR project files. | 242 |
| A repository that generates runtime source trees for AdaCore's bare metal targets | 65 |
| A small, quick compiler written in Ada for the Ada programming language | 127 |
| Compiles Accelerate code to LLVM IR and executes it on CPUs or NVIDIA GPUs | 159 |
| A language and compiler for systems programming with a focus on simplicity, ease of implementation, and extension points | 28 |